Controller Area Network (CAN) (Mazda 6 GG)

The PCM unit transmits/receives information from CAN.

The Controller Area Network (CAN) transmits the following information:
  • torque reduction inhibition;
  • engine speed;
  • vehicle speed;
  • throttle position;
  • coolant temperature;
  • path traveled;
  • fuel injection (quantity);
  • mIL status;
  • generator warning light status;
  • engine cylinder displacement;
  • number of cylinders;
  • intake system type;
  • fuel type and supply;
  • country;
  • gearbox/axle type;
  • wheel circumference (front/rear);
  • desired gear shift position;
  • hOLD switch state.

The Controller Area Network (CAN) receives the following information:
  • wheel speed from anti-lock brake system;
  • front left;
  • front right;
  • rear left;
  • rear right;
  • distance traveled from anti-lock braking system;
  • condition of the brake system from the anti-lock braking system;
  • anti-lock brake system torque reduction request;
  • brake system configuration from anti-lock braking system.

Fig. 2.230. Electrical diagram of the control system of the Mazda 6 with the L8, LF engine (general area) and L3: 1 – electric motor of cooling system fan No.1; 2 – electric motor of cooling system fan No.2; 3 – Cooling system fan relay No.1; 4 – Cooling system fan relay No.2; 5 – Cooling system fan relay No.3; 6 – Cooling system fan relay No.4; 7 – PCM block; 8 – L3 engines; 9 – LF and L8 engines (hot area)

Fig. 2.231. Electrical diagram of the control system of the Mazda 6 with the L8, LF engine (general area): 1 – electric motor of cooling system fan No.1; 2 – electric motor of cooling system fan No.2; 3 – Cooling system fan relay No.1; 4 – Cooling system fan relay No.2; 5 – PCM block; 6 – with air conditioning system
